We had a GREAT trip to Panama! It was such a break from the hustle and bustle here in teh states. I have written a little about each place we stayed for your information and future recommendations. Crowne Plaza (Panama City): I know this was a last minute switch due to some internal flight changes in Panama, but this is the one place I wouldn`t recommend. There was nothing really bad about it- and we walked to eat lunch and dinner, but the pool was small, the place smelled very very musty, and it was pretty empty. I would be interested to check out other hotels in the city in the same price range. Dad Ibe (San Blas): We LOVED LOVED LOVED Dad Ibe. The owner and his staff are unbeatable. Juan, who used to work at Yandup now works at Dad Ibe and he is the best guide. Very down to Earth, took us wherever we wanted to go, and explained so well. We went snorkeling twice and then to the Kuna Village. We (well the 2 staff members) caught our dinner one time when we went snorkeling, so that was exciting. The no electricity, hot water whole thing was just so refreshing, and the place is beautiful. And not one single mosquito!! not one! Some things travelers should probably keep in mind is to bring some books or cards. And also we found it got a little hot at night in the cabin, so just be prepared, there, of course, are no fans as there isn`t electricity past 10pm. Hotel Playa Tortuga (Bocas del Toro): Yes! We loved La Playa! I wasn`t sure after landing in Bocas if we would be staying in a place just as rustic as San Blas, but then we saw La Playa Tortuga. Very hospitable, convenient, the free shuttle is awesome. Taxi`s are also pretty frequent and can take you there to town or vice versa for 2.50/person. The pool is great, and the free breakfast is very generous. I would encourage travelers to go to 3rd street to some of the tour places there rather than go through Playa Tortuga for tours, though. We did one tour through the hotel and they stuck us on a 40 horsepower boat with 8 adults. It took us sooooo long to get anywhere and all the other boats just breezed past us. While we love seeing the ocean and it was a nice boat ride, it felt like they just cattle herded us onto this boat knowing how slow we would be and didn`t really care. The next day we went into town, 3rd street to the Bocas run tour office at the very end of the street and got a private tour in a boat twice as big for the exact same cost. So much better. We had a guide all to ourselves and we could spend more time at the actual sights rather than boating to get there. Gamboa Rainforest Lodge (Panama City): Well, we ended our trip here, and it couldn`t have been a better ending! It was sooooo beautiful- the view, the pools, the whole thing. The room was very comfortable and the restaurants convenient. A little pricey, but as we were only there 2 days, it wasn`t bad. We ate at the poolside bar too and the bar tender created a fruit platter for us that was not even on the menu. The tour desk was so helpful, my husband did the fishing tour (3 hours) and was NOT disappointed. One of the best experiences he had- he went early and saw (or heard) howler monkeys, alligators, and tons of peacock bass. We also did the monkey island tour which proved true to its name and we saw lots of cute monos. Also, they don`t advertise it too well, but for $15 each you can go use the Clarins spa `water facilities`, the steam room, suana, hot tub. We were the only ones there so it was a great spa experience without getting an actual treatment. All the drivers for our transfers were there and on time. The internal flights worked well- San Blas being the easiest. We had a slight delay coming back from Bocas b/c of the weather and that airport is under construction...yikes. No running water, all dusty, not the place you want to be waiting for too long, but it is close to the town so we left to go grab lunch. All-in-all, I would highly recommmend your website to any of my friends or family. The organization and detailed itinerary, the insurance which is spelled out so clearly, the online ease of planning your trip- unbeatable. Brenda really did us right, as my husband says. We had the experience of a lifetime in Panama and hope we paid it forward with our reviews above. Thanks.
